Empowering Cross-Platform Development and Team Collaboration
Visual Studio Professional 2026 stands out as a versatile development powerhouse, providing comprehensive support for a multitude of languages and platforms, thus empowering developers to create diverse applications without constraints. The IDE facilitates the creation of .NET MAUI applications for seamless deployment across mobile and desktop environments, enabling a unified codebase for varied user interfaces. Additionally, it supports the development of dynamic web interfaces using Blazor, and accommodates .NET and C++ projects targeting Windows, Linux, and containerized deployments. A standout feature, Hot Reload, allows for instantaneous application of code changes while an application is actively running, dramatically shortening development cycles by minimizing the need for constant restarts during testing and iteration. This flexibility ensures that developers can tackle any project, regardless of its target platform or technological stack.
Beyond its extensive platform support, Visual Studio Professional 2026 excels in fostering a collaborative development environment, making it an ideal choice for teams. Features like CodeLens provide developers with invaluable contextual information directly within the editor, such as recent code changes, authors, test statuses, and commit histories, enhancing code understanding and accountability. Complementing this, Live Share revolutionizes team workflows by enabling real-time collaboration on code and debugging sessions. This means team members can work together on the same codebase simultaneously, irrespective of their physical location, without the hassle of cloning repositories or configuring identical development dependencies. This seamless collaboration capability streamlines project coordination, accelerates problem-solving, and ensures that teams can operate with maximum efficiency and cohesion, delivering projects on time and with high quality.
